16,916 people State Wisconsin Land area 822 sq mi Density 20.6 per sq mi Median income $62,819 Median age 56.0 FIPS code 55013
Interactive maps and statistics for Burnett County, Wisconsin: income, age, education, housing, health and more, set beside Wisconsin and the United States.
Burnett County, Wisconsin is among the highest in the country for median age (44th of 3,222 counties), and among the highest in the country for homeownership rate (87th of 3,222 counties).
